Getting from Catania Fontanarossa Airport (CTA) to central Catania
From Catania Fontanarossa Airport, central Catania is around 6 kilometers away. It takes about 20 minutes to reach the city center by car.
It takes roughly 25 minutes if you're using public transport.

The best time to fly from Bangkok to Catania Fontanarossa Airport (CTA)
January is the quietest month for flights from Bangkok to Catania Fontanarossa Airport (CTA), while July is the most popular. Choose the ideal time to go to Catania based on whether you like a laid-back vibe or a more bustling atmosphere.
The warmest month in Catania is July, with temperatures ranging between 21ºC (70ºF) and 36ºC (97ºF). Lock in your Bangkok to CTA plane ticket then if that's your definition of good weather.
February has temperatures of between 4ºC (39ºF) and 18ºC (64ºF). Look for cheap tickets from Bangkok to Catania Fontanarossa Airport around that time if you like traveling in cooler conditions.
